SN74AUP2G125DQER Description

SN74AUP2G125DQER Description

The SN74AUP2G125DQER is a high-performance buffer from Texas Instruments, designed to meet the demands of modern electronic systems. This device features a 3.6V operation, making it suitable for low-voltage applications. With a supply voltage range of 0.8V to 3.6V, it offers flexibility in various power supply configurations. The SN74AUP2G125DQER is surface-mountable, ensuring easy integration into compact designs.

SN74AUP2G125DQER Features

  • Technical Specifications:

    • Number of Bits per Element: 1
    • Number of Elements: 2
    • Voltage - Supply: 0.8V ~ 3.6V
    • Current - Output High, Low: 4mA, 4mA
    • Moisture Sensitivity Level (MSL): 1 (Unlimited)
    • RoHS Status: ROHS3 Compliant
    • REACH Status: REACH Unaffected
